|
Lançamento do inventário de um produto do Estoque.
| Nome | Tipo | Comentários |
EMPRESA | SMALLINT | Código da Empresa |
FILIAL | SMALLINT | Código da Filial |
NR_CAPA | INT | Número da capa de lote do inventário |
NR_FICHA | INT | Número da ficha da capa de lote do inventário |
ESTAB | SMALLINT | Código do Estabelecimento do Produto |
DEPOSITO | SMALLINT | Código do Depósito do Produto |
C_PROD | CHAR(14) | Código do Produto |
LOTE | INT | Número do lote do produto a ser inventariado. Caso não seja controlado por lote, informe zero |
PALETE | INT | Informar Zero |
SEQ_REGISTRO | INT | Número sequencial de manutenção do registro |
| DT_MOVTO | SMALLDATETIME | Não é preciso informar, campo não será considerado |
| ID_MES_FEC | VARCHAR(1) | Use 'S' para indicar capa lote de mês fechado ou N' para capa de mês ainda aberto no ERP |
| TP_ACERTO | VARCHAR(2) | Tipo do acerto de saldo a ser executado: 'Q' = Preencher somente o campo de quantidade. 'QZ' = Zera somente a quantidade do produto. 'ZC' = Zera a quantidade, o valor total, o custo total e o custo médio em moeda corrente do produto. 'VC' = Preencher quantidade e/ou valor unitário e/ou valor total, quando for utilizada a moeda corrente. Não há a necessidade se de informar os três campos, apenas dois, o terceiro será calculado pelo software. 'UC' = Preencher somente o campo de valor unitário quando for utilizada a moeda corrente. |
| QTDE | NUMERIC(15,6) | Quantidade do produto ou produto/lote. Campo tratado apenas para tipo de acerto 'Quantidade' |
| VR_TOTAL | NUMERIC(15,4) | Valor total correto em estoque do produto ou produto/lote. Campo será considerado apenas nos tipos de acerto de Valor Total |
| VR_UNIT | NUMERIC(15,6) | Valor unitário correto do produto ou produto/lote. Campo será considerado apenas nos tipos de acerto de Valor Unitário |
| TIPO_MANUT | VARCHAR (3) | Indica o tipo da manutenção : “INC” – inclusão “EXC” – exclusão “ALT” – alteração |
| REG_EXP_IMP | VARCHAR (3) | Indica se é uma importação ou exportação do registro no sistema. IMP - importação (de outro sistema para o ERP) EXP - exportação (do ERP para outro sistema) |
| ORIGEM_REG | VARCHAR (20) | Texto indicando a origem do registro. |
| PROC_ORIGEM | VARCHAR (20) | Identificação do processo de origem |
| CAMPO_USUA1 | VARCHAR(50) | Campo para livre utilização (não será utilizado pela ABC71) |
| CAMPO_USUA2 | VARCHAR(50) | Campo para livre utilização (não será utilizado pela ABC71) |
| CAMPO_USUA3 | VARCHAR(50) | Campo para livre utilização (não será utilizado pela ABC71) |
| CAMPO_USUA4 | VARCHAR(50) | Campo para livre utilização (não será utilizado pela ABC71) |
| CAMPO_USUA5 | VARCHAR(50) | Campo para livre utilização (não será utilizado pela ABC71) |
| STATUS_REG | VARCHAR(1) | Indica o atual status do registro : “N” – não processado “P” – processado “E” – com erro no processamento |
| MSG_ERRO | VARCHAR(250) | Caso o campo STATUS_REG seja “E”, a mensagem de erro correspondente será armazenada neste campo |
| RESERVADO_01 | SMALLINT | |
| RESERVADO_02 | SMALLINT | |
| RESERVADO_03 | INT | |
| RESERVADO_04 | INT | |
| RESERVADO_05 | NUMERIC(14,0) | |
| RESERVADO_06 | NUMERIC(14,0) | |
| RESERVADO_07 | NUMERIC(15,6) | |
| RESERVADO_08 | NUMERIC(15,6) | |
| RESERVADO_09 | INT | |
| RESERVADO_10 | INT | |
| RESERVADO_11 | VARCHAR(50) | |
| RESERVADO_12 | VARCHAR(50) | |
| OPERADOR | VARCHAR(10) | Responsavel pela Última Alteração |
| DATA_ALTER | SMALLDATETIME | Data da Última Alteração |
| HORA_ALTER | SMALLINT | Hora da Última Alteração |
| TIME_STAMP | SMALLINT | Controle de Acesso ao Registro |
